What our client expects of a Systems Implementer & Trainer

You will be joining our client at an exciting time - they are currently rolling out a raft of new systems and reimagining their entire systems infrastructure, alongside a host of other great new projects. You will help shape a new e-commerce experience for more than 100,000 customers and 600 co-owners.

Navigating business change, and the continuous improvement of the systems which supports the business is imperative to the future success of the organisation. Implementation and training allows our client to deliver on that exciting and frequently challenging remit. For the company to succeed, our client has to work together both as a technology department but also as a support and advocate for the change that they bring. Our client frequently implements projects with tens of thousands of customers, and hundreds of stakeholders all impacting jobs and lives. Helping implement, deliver and train these projects is the core of how our client sees this role.

Working in the Business System team you will help deliver the ambitious roadmap and architecture of the production and logistics systems amongst others. The first project is an ambitious one, delivering our client’s new logistics platform by helping implement the solution and train both drivers and office users on all elements of the system from the devices that sit in vans through to the back office and communication platform that delivers many customer benefits. The project will be running throughout 2019 and will totally re-write the way our client operates their last-mile fleet. In addition, there will be responsibility for training the 1st line support team and some retained responsibility for 2nd line support of the system after go-live.

This project alone will bring with it a need to devise implementation and training plans and then carry them out. Training & documentation may take different forms, from producing videos, written guides and delivering classroom style training as appropriate.

On the road, you will be delivering training and guidance working with in-house Logistics teams as well as Franchisees and approximately 200 drivers.

This is a huge change project moving drivers from paper-based processes to tablets, and out in the field you will be the change ambassador - this cannot be overlooked, personality and the ability to support co-workers through change is fundamental to the success in this role.
